Financial Quantitative Analysts H-1B salary at Capital Research and Management Company: $164,112 average ($114,426-$246,000 range). 100% approval rate.
With 9 H-1B filings, Capital Research and Management Company is an active sponsor of Financial Quantitative Analysts positions at an average salary of $164k. The average offered salary of $164k is 70% above the prevailing wage for this occupation. Most positions are located in California (89%), New York (11%). The certification rate is 100%. 22% of these filings are for new employment.
